Release notes for v4014
Add support for a license server
We added support for local license server that re-routes requests to Cryptolens. You can read more about it here.
Assuming your license server runs on localhost with port 8080 (default), you can access it by adding LicenseServerUrl
as shown below:
var licenseKey = "GEBNC-WZZJD-VJIHG-GCMVD";
var RSAPubKey = "{enter the RSA Public key here}";
var auth = "{access token with permission to access the activate method}";
var result = Key.Activate(token: auth, parameters: new ActivateModel()
{
Key = licenseKey,
ProductId = 3349,
Sign = true,
MachineCode = Helpers.GetMachineCode()
LicenseServerUrl = "http://localhost:8080/" // <- add this line
});
if (result == null || result.Result == ResultType.Error ||
!result.LicenseKey.HasValidSignature(RSAPubKey).IsValid())
{
// an error occurred or the key is invalid or it cannot be activated
// (eg. the limit of activated devices was achieved)
Console.WriteLine("The license does not work.");
}
else
{
// everything went fine if we are here!
Console.WriteLine("The license is valid!");
}
Console.ReadLine();
This works for all models, so you can do the same with eg. Deactivate.
